Prime Minister of St Kitts and Nevis, Dr Terrance Drew, extended greetings and congratulations to Joshua Williams for his match in the NFL Super Bowl 57 on Sunday, February 12, 2023, at 7: 30 pm.

PM Terrance Drew took to social media and lauded Joshua Williams for his outstanding achievement. He cited,” Joshua Williams, a citizen of St Kitts and Nevis, will play in the 57th edition of the NFL Super Bowl on the evening of Sunday, February 12 2023. The match will start at 7:30 PM.”

Previously, Williams played for the team of Fayetteville State University. He graduated from the University in 2017. Following this, he was selected by the Kansas City Chiefs in April 2022. Currently, Williams plays as a cornerback representing the team.

Joshua Williams is the youngest of three children. He is the son of George Williams’ a former resident of Molineux, St Kitts and Nevis.

In September 2022, the NFL selected more than 200 players, coaches, and other executives to participate in a new player-led initiative. The said initiative celebrated international diversity. Through this, each player was allowed to represent their nationality or cultural heritage.

A total of five Kansas City Chiefs players participated in this initiative. Meanwhile, Joshua Williams plays as a proud representative of our twin islands, St Kitts and Nevis. Additionally, He was the first Fayetteville State player to be invited to the college football Senior Bowl.

An article was published by ABC11 in which they highlighted Joshua Williams. The publication stated that his outstanding performance on the field last Sunday pushed his team to the title game. “Williams made a big fourth-quarter interception for the Chiefs in their 23-20 AFC Championship win against the defending AFC titlist Cincinnati Bengals”.

PM Dr Terrance Drew expressed pleasure and stated that this is an exciting time for all nationals of Saint Kitts and Nevis.

“I extend best wishes to Williams and his family on this outstanding achievement and look forward to a repeat of his remarkable performance in tonight’s game, “said the prime minister.w
